The Heart of Leadership: Prioritization

At its core, time management allows leaders to prioritize tasks. Think about it: a leader’s day is often filled with meetings, emails, and urgent requests that can easily distract even the most focused among us. That’s where prioritization comes into play. When leaders can effectively sort tasks into “urgent” and “important,” they can focus their energy where it counts. This means high-impact activities that drive the mission forward get the attention they deserve.

Imagine a ship captain navigating treacherous waters. If scattered by multiple competing interests, the ship risks running aground. However, a leader who skillfully manages their time acts like that captain—steering the crew towards their destination, making sure everyone knows which direction to head in.

Teamwork: A Symbiotic Relationship with Time Management

Now, let’s touch on teamwork because that’s often where you see time management play out in action. Effective leaders who manage time well create an environment for strong collaboration. When a leader delineates tasks clearly based on priority, team members know what they should focus on without stepping on each other’s toes—kind of like dancers in a well-choreographed routine, you know?

When team members are clear about their roles and responsibilities, communication blossoms. It’s fascinating how clarity breeds confidence and fosters an atmosphere where everyone can contribute. A cohesive team naturally becomes more productive, which brings us back to those precious hours we’ve got to work with.

Communication: The Unsung Hero of Time Management

Speaking of communication! A leader who’s on top of their time-management game doesn’t just delegate tasks—they enhance communication within their team. How? By ensuring that everyone is aligned with the mission and knows the chain of command. Clear communication can help clarify what needs immediate attention versus what can wait. Plus, it builds trust among team members, which is priceless.

Picture this: a leader sends out a brief update that highlights the week’s key tasks and deadlines. Team members appreciate it—they feel informed and ready to take the necessary actions. It’s a ripple effect—when you handle your time well, you not only benefit, but your entire gang reaps the rewards too.

Decision-Making: A Skill Sharpened by Managing Minutes, Not Just Months

Here’s the kicker: effective time management leads to better decision-making. When leaders can sift through the noise and focus on what’s truly important, they are equipped to make timely and informed decisions. Let’s face it—when the clock is ticking, making the best choice can sometimes feel like trying to find a needle in a haystack.

Good leaders, however, don’t get lost in the weeds. They filter through the chaos and hone in on vital data that guides their choices. This isn't just about being fast; it’s about being smart. By ensuring that time is spent on analyzing the most impactful elements, they set themselves up for success.
